Smart phone war: See how Samsung ad mocks Apple's iPhone 5

This article was contributed by the STOMP Team.

Samsung has struck the latest blow against Apple in the war of smart phone manufacturers, with a point by point comparison between the iPhone 5 and their latest offering, the Galaxy S3.

Their ad's tag line 'It doesn't take a genius' mocks Apple's customer service 'Geniuses', who provide help at Apple's retail stores.

The ad comes shortly after a US court ordered Samsung to pay Apple US$1.05 billion (S$1.3 billion) for "wilfully" infringing six Apple patents for smartphones or tablet PCs.
